Jill Shalvis is a New York Times bestselling writer of over 50 romance novels. She is the author of the Lucky Harbor series, Animal Attraction, Animal Magnetism, and Slow Heat. She has won several awards including the National Readers' Choice award three times. She has also written under the vis mere pseudonym Jill Sheldon. Jill's title's, My Kind of Wonderful, Cedar Ridge series book 2, One Snowy Night: A Heartbreaker Bay Christmas Novella, and Accidentally on Purpose made the New York Times List . After finding an old gold coin in a box of her father's things, Anna now finds herself on a mission to prove that he didn't steal it, along with a Ruby Red necklace. Owen's been wanting to find his great-aunt's heirloom necklace for her for years and when he sees a news story about a gold coin that could be the first clue in years, he's not going to leave Anna's side. As a private investigator, Anna feels she has it covered but Owen's worried she'll lie to protect her father's reputation, so they find themselves working together and deluding themselves that “Once to get it out of our system!” is the solution for the building chemistry they find between themselves.
Owen honestly hadn't known he was into sharp, cynical, feisty firecrackers with a side of sweet, but apparently there was a first time for everything.
The Summer Escape is in the Sunrise Cove series but borrows from the setting, rather than continued character story lines, you could just pick this up. Anna's our late twenties character, who has the more interesting job of private investigator, but other than a grab your attention beginning dealing with the consequences of such a job, I'm not sure it was fully utilized to it's potential. Her father died a year ago and she's still dealing with the grief when she finds the gold coin. With her older sister Wendy pushing her, she takes it to a pawn shop to get appraised, which kicks off the whole chain of events. Wendy plays a decent sized role in this, she's eight months pregnant with triplets and because she's on bed-rest, feels the need to “come along” with Anna on her investigation (Go-Pro and Air Pods). We also get povs from Wendy, which fine, but your enjoyment of this story is going to come down to if you get annoyed with Wendy being “there” in a good portion of Anna and Owen scenes. I fell more on the annoyed side, especially when Anna and Owen were getting to know one another and some chemistry was trying to build, only to be “humorously” interrupted by Wendy. Your mileage may vary.
“We said this wasn't happening. We're wrong for each other.” She didn't like the desperation in her voice.
If you're a frequent Shalvis reader, you'll get some of that easy flowing sweet and flirty chemistry that she's known for, but a little less of the fun and light. This had Anna dealing with her grief, and fear that her dad was a thief, tarnishing his halo a bit to her and Owen having some of his own grief with his great-aunt suffering and declining from dementia. These two ruminated in these emotional upheavals, along with Anna not thinking she was good enough for Owen and Owen, faintly, because he seems just about all in pretty quickly, shaking off his playboy demeanor/past. I missed more of the fun falling in love, with some emotional hurdles, that I love Shalvis for, because this was more of rinse and repeat Anna saying a relationship between them would never work. If you like your characters to therapist chair talk to each other (this could be me being a tad dramatic) instead of flirt on, like, a kitchen counter, this would be more for you.
She met his gave. “We can't get too attached, right?”
And wasn't that the problem, because he was beginning to realize he was already very attached, and...he wanted more, far more.
The investigation to find out who stole the coins and necklace, was fairly weak, I kept waiting for our private investigator Anna to do a lot more. She has a police officer friend give her the name of suspects from the original theft case, and there is some going to talk to a few people, but overall, didn't feel super active (which, I guess, real but not real entertaining) A danger blast from the past arrives later in the story to give us some action in the end and answers to the coins and necklace questions. The danger gives Anna a chance to open her eyes and realize what she really wants from life to give us the HEA.
